首页 > 资讯 > 严选问答 >

c语言是什么意思

2026-01-22 09:42:21
最佳答案

c语言是什么意思】“C语言是什么意思”是许多初学者在学习编程时常常提出的问题。C语言是一种广泛使用的编程语言,它不仅历史悠久,而且在计算机科学中具有重要的地位。理解C语言的含义和特点,有助于更好地掌握其应用与价值。

一、C语言的定义与背景

C语言是由丹尼斯·里奇(Dennis Ritchie)于1972年在贝尔实验室开发的一种通用、高效、灵活的编程语言。最初设计用于开发UNIX操作系统,后来逐渐成为全球最流行的编程语言之一。

C语言的特点包括:

- 高效性:直接操作内存,运行速度快。

- 灵活性强:可以用于系统编程、嵌入式开发、应用开发等多种场景。

- 可移植性强:代码可以在不同平台上编译运行。

- 语法简洁:结构清晰,易于学习和使用。

二、C语言的核心概念

概念 定义
变量 存储数据的基本单元,需声明类型。
数据类型 包括整型、浮点型、字符型等,决定变量存储方式。
函数 由多个语句组成的代码块,实现特定功能。
指针 存储内存地址的变量,用于直接访问内存。
数组 存储相同类型数据的集合,通过索引访问元素。
结构体 将不同类型的数据组合成一个整体。

三、C语言的应用领域

应用领域 说明
操作系统开发 如UNIX、Linux等系统内核多用C语言编写。
嵌入式系统 因其高效性和对硬件的直接控制能力,广泛应用于单片机等设备。
驱动程序开发 C语言常用于编写硬件设备的驱动程序。
高性能计算 在需要快速执行的算法或系统中,C语言被广泛采用。
游戏开发 一些游戏引擎和底层逻辑使用C语言进行优化。

四、C语言的学习意义

学习C语言不仅可以帮助你理解计算机底层原理,还能为后续学习其他高级语言(如C++、Java、Python等)打下坚实基础。此外,C语言的广泛适用性使其成为程序员必备技能之一。

五、总结

“C语言是什么意思”其实是一个关于编程语言基本概念的问题。C语言是一种高效、灵活且广泛应用的编程语言,适用于多种开发场景。通过学习C语言,你可以深入理解程序运行机制,提升编程能力,并为未来的职业发展提供更多可能性。

项目 内容
定义 一种通用、高效的编程语言,由Dennis Ritchie开发。
特点 高效、灵活、可移植性强、语法简洁。
应用 操作系统、嵌入式系统、驱动程序、高性能计算等。
学习价值 理解底层原理,提升编程能力,为其他语言打基础。

通过以上内容,我们可以更清晰地理解“C语言是什么意思”,并认识到它在编程世界中的重要地位。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。